Crankcase (pcv) problems of the 2009 BMW 528

Three problems related to crankcase (pcv) have been reported for the 2009 BMW 528. The most recently reported issues are listed below. Please also check out the statistics and reliability analysis of the 2009 BMW 528 based on all problems reported for the 2009 528.

1 Crankcase (pcv) problem

Failure Date: 10/01/2021

I took the 2009 BMW 528i to bridgeport BMW to have a prior safety recall (17v-673/19v-273) repaired but, it wasn't fixed and my car caught on fire last year before I got another recall letter stating that there's no remedy for the recall campaign no. 22v-119: pcv valve heater.

2 Crankcase (pcv) problem

Failure Date: 04/28/2018

In December 2017 recall was issued regarding engine component known as positive crankcase ventilation (pcv) valve heater. Called my local BMW of peabody MA and I was told that the components will be available on late January 2018 and I will informed by mail. Car smoking on and off I made sure they have my name and address. As of September 2018, there's no contact lack of service and concerns.

3 Crankcase (pcv) problem

Failure Date: 10/30/2017

Nhtsa recall number17v683 recall issued for faulty pcv valve heater in October 2017 with no remedy as of today, September 10, 2018.
